Warning Signs You Need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ration

Catching water damage early is crucial to preventing further damage and reducing the risk of health risks. Here are some common warning signs to look out for: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Is there a lingering smell of mildew or mildew in your home? This could be a sign that there’s water damage present. Don’t ignore it – investigate and address the issue immediately.

Warped or Buckled Laminate

Is your laminate floor looking uneven or buckled? This could be a sign that water damage has occurred. Don’t wait until it’s too late – contact us today to schedule a consultation.

Water Stains or Discoloration

Are there water stains or discoloration on your laminate floor? This could be a sign that water damage has occurred. Don’t ignore it – address the issue immediately to prevent further damage.

Soft or Squishy Laminate

Is your laminate floor feeling soft or squishy to the touch? This could be a sign that water damage has occurred. Don’t delay – contact us today to schedule a consultation.

Peeling or Cracking Laminate

Is your laminate floor peeling or cracking? This could be a sign that water damage has occurred. Don’t wait until it’s too late – contact us today to schedule a consultation.

Unusual Noises or Sounds

Are you hearing unusual noises or sounds coming from your laminate floor? This could be a sign that water damage has occurred. Don’t ignore it – investigate and address the issue immediately.

Laminate Floor Water Damage Restoration Cost in Waterloo

The cost of laminate floor water damage restoration can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Waterloo. These estimates are based on average prices and may vary depending on your specific situation. Pricing varies based on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Containment and ext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area and severity of damage
Drying and d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area and severity of damage
Removal and replacement of damaged laminate $2,000 – $10,000 Size of affected area and severity of damage
Repairs to underlying structure $1,500 – $7,500 Severity of damage and complexity of repairs
More costs for mold remediation or other services $500 – $2,000 Severity of damage and complexity of repairs
Total cost for laminate floor water damage restoration $5,000 – $25,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and complexity of repairs
